Projektgeschichte und Nutzung

Kokkos is a C++ performance-portability ecosystem for writing parallel code that can target different CPU and accelerator backends. The Homebrew package exposes developer tools such as nvcc_wrapper and kokkos_launch_compiler, making a large HPC programming model feel like a normal installable developer dependency.

Projektgeschichte

Kokkos originated in the U.S. Department of Energy national-lab HPC world, with Sandia National Laboratories as the original developer. Its early evolution moved from node abstractions around 2008-2010 into a fuller programming model around 2010-2014, combining execution abstractions with data abstractions.

The 2014 Kokkos paper described the core idea: applications and domain libraries need performance portability across manycore architectures, and memory access patterns are as important as parallel execution. Sandia describes the Kokkos ecosystem as released in 2017 to provide a vendor-independent performance-portable programming system for scientific, engineering, and mathematical C++ applications.

The project later became part of the Linux Foundation's High Performance Software Foundation ecosystem. Kokkos documentation describes Core as the programming model, with related projects for math kernels, profiling/debugging tools, Python bindings, remote spaces, and resilience/checkpointing.

Adoptionsgeschichte

Kokkos adoption tracks the HPC shift from single-architecture tuning toward heterogeneous systems with NVIDIA, AMD, Intel, and CPU backends. Its support for CUDA, HIP, SYCL, HPX, OpenMP, and C++ threads made it a common portability layer for DOE and scientific codes preparing for exascale machines.

Package-manager adoption matters because Kokkos is often both a library dependency and a compiler-wrapper/tooling dependency. Making it available through Homebrew, Linux distribution packages, MacPorts, Nix, and openSUSE helps developers test and build performance-portable code outside facility-specific software stacks.

Wie es verwendet wird

Users build C++ applications against Kokkos Core to express parallel execution policies and memory spaces without hard-coding one backend. The package's CLI-visible tools support compilation flows, especially CUDA-oriented builds through wrappers such as nvcc_wrapper.

In practice, Kokkos often appears inside larger scientific applications and libraries rather than as an end-user command. Its package entry is still valuable because the build system has to find headers, libraries, compiler wrappers, enabled backends, and compatible C++ compiler settings.

Warum Paket-Nerds sich dafür interessieren

Kokkos is a stress test for package systems because it is C++, HPC, backend-sensitive, and toolchain-sensitive. A good package has to expose enough knobs for OpenMP, CUDA, HIP, SYCL, and compiler integration without making every user rebuild a bespoke supercomputer stack.

It is also a marker of HPC software moving into mainstream package indexes. Homebrew carrying Kokkos means macOS and workstation developers can inspect, compile, and prototype with an exascale-era programming model before moving to clusters.

Zeitleiste

  • 2008-2010: Kokkos history materials describe early node abstractions and sparse-kernel work.
  • 2010-2014: Kokkos evolved into a complete programming model with execution and data abstractions.
  • 2014: The original Kokkos paper appeared in Journal of Parallel and Distributed Computing.
  • 2017: Sandia describes the Kokkos ecosystem as released for vendor-independent performance portability.
  • 2020-02-28: GitHub release metadata records Kokkos 3.0.00.
  • 2023-03-03: GitHub release metadata records Kokkos 4.0.00.

Related projects

  • The Kokkos ecosystem includes kokkos-kernels, kokkos-tools, pykokkos, kokkos-remote-spaces, and kokkos-resilience. It is used alongside HPC projects and libraries such as Trilinos and LAMMPS, and conceptually relates to RAJA, OpenMP, CUDA, HIP, SYCL, and C++ standardization efforts such as mdspan.
